Uploaded image for project: 'Ibexa IBX'
  1. Ibexa IBX
  2. IBX-6449

Can't add a new translation for the page builder without the always available flag

    XMLWordPrintable

Details

    • Yes

    Description

      Steps to reproduce

      1. Install Ibexa DXP v4.5 
      2. Add two languages e.g. pol-PL and fre-FR
      3. Create two folders in the main location
      4. configure two siteaccess with tree_root:
              site_fr:
                  languages: [ fre-FR ]
                  content:
                      tree_root:
                          location_id: 67
              site_pl:
                  languages: [ pol-PL ]
                  content:
                      tree_root:
                          location_id: 68 
      1. Add site accesses to ibexa.siteaccess.list, ibexa.siteaccess.group, and ibexa.system.admin_group.page_builder.siteaccess_list.
      2. Add added languages to ibexa.system.admin_group.languages
      3. Change flag always available to false for landing page content type
      4. Add landing page (use French) under site_fr root location (67)
      5. Add a new location for the added landing page under  site_pl root location (68)
      6. Add translation(Polish) to the added landing page under site_pl root location (68)

      Result

      When preview mode is loaded display the error: NoMatchingSiteAccessFoundException

      Expected result:
      A preview should be rendered properly.

      Designs

        Attachments

          Activity

            People

              Unassigned Unassigned
              mateusz.debinski@ibexa.co Mateusz Dębiński
              Votes:
              4 Vote for this issue
              Watchers:
              4 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: